WebApr 3, 2024 · Double hollyhocks (such as Chater’s Double Group and ‘Peaches ’n’ Dreams’) have peony-like flowers on tall stems in summer. They are short-lived perennials grown as biennials and can be sown in spring or early fall, or bought as potted plants and planted between May and October. WebJan 9, 2024 · To plant a peony in a container, use light potting soil. While peonies in the garden will tolerate poorer soils, when planting them in containers, light potting soil is best. Peonies like nice light free draining soil. Starting them off in potting soil will allow water to drain away from the roots of the peony.
